ChatGPT批量写原创文章软件

网站搜索功能如何实现快速精准查询

在信息爆炸的互联网时代,用户对网站搜索功能的期待早已超越了简单的关键词匹配。当用户输入查询内容时,背后涉及的技术体系如同精密运转的齿轮组,既要理解人类语言的复杂性,又要兼顾

在信息爆炸的互联网时代,用户对网站搜索功能的期待早已超越了简单的关键词匹配。当用户输入查询内容时,背后涉及的技术体系如同精密运转的齿轮组,既要理解人类语言的复杂性,又要兼顾海量数据的处理效率。如何让要求既快又准,成为衡量网站核心竞争力的重要指标。

数据预处理优化

高效搜索的基石始于数据预处理。网站每天新增的文本、图像、视频等非结构化数据,需要通过清洗、分词、语义标注等步骤转化为可检索的结构化信息。以电商平台为例,商品标题中的"苹果"可能是水果品牌也可能是电子产品,基于上下文语境建立实体识别模型能有效避免歧义。

网站搜索功能如何实现快速精准查询

先进的预处理系统会采用动态更新机制。麻省理工学院2023年的研究显示,实时更新的词向量库能使搜索相关性提升28%。某头部新闻网站通过建立领域专用词库,将政治类报道中"主席"与"总统"的识别准确率提升至97%,显著改善了跨语种搜索体验。

索引技术升级

倒排索引技术的革新直接决定检索速度。传统B+树结构虽能保证有序性,但在处理数亿级文档时面临性能瓶颈。Elasticsearch采用的分布式倒排索引,通过分片机制将索引文件拆解存储在不同节点,某电商平台实测查询响应时间从800ms降至120ms。

向量索引的突破为多模态搜索开辟新路径。结合HNSW(可导航小世界图)算法,图像特征向量检索速度提升40倍。国际计算机视觉会议ICCV2024的最新论文证实,混合索引架构在保持96%召回率的前提下,将十亿级向量检索耗时压缩到50ms以内。

算法模型创新

Transformer架构的进化重构了语义理解范式。谷歌搜索团队2023年推出的MUM(多任务统一模型),能同时处理75种语言的跨模态查询。在旅游网站场景测试中,对"适合带孩子住的安静酒店"这类复杂查询,结果相关度评分提升31%。

实时反馈机制成为算法优化的加速器。亚马逊的A9算法引入点击热力图分析,通过用户实际点击行为动态调整排序权重。当用户频繁跳过某些高匹配度结果时,系统会在15分钟内自动降低其排名,这种动态调优机制使转化率提高19%。

响应速度提升

分布式架构设计是应对高并发的关键。某票务平台采用Redis集群缓存热点搜索词,配合边缘计算节点实现地域化缓存,在百万级并发场景下,首屏渲染时间稳定在400ms以内。CDN网络优化方面,阿里云全球加速方案可将跨国搜索延迟降低65%。

冷启动优化取得重要突破。拼多多研发的预加载算法能预测用户潜在搜索意图,在用户输入前完成80%的数据准备。实际测试表明,这种预测式加载技术使首词输入响应速度提升3倍,尤其在移动端弱网环境下效果显著。

用户体验融合

个性化搜索已进入情境感知阶段。携程APP通过分析用户历史订单和浏览轨迹,自动识别商务出行或休闲旅游场景。当检测到用户近期频繁搜索会议场地时,酒店要求会优先显示商务型酒店和会议室配置信息。

视觉交互革新改变搜索形态。Pinterest的视觉搜索工具支持图片局部区域框选检索,其采用的注意力机制模型能精准识别选定区域的材质、纹理等特征。测试数据显示,这种交互方式使家居类商品的搜索转化率提升42%。

相关文章

推荐文章